Understanding the Software Development Lifecycle

Phases of the SDLC

The SDLC consists of distinct phases that guide software development. Initially, the planning phase identifies project requirements and objectives. This sets the foundation for subsequent steps. Next, the design phase outlines system architecture and user interfaces. Clear designs facilitate smoother development. Following this, the development phase involves coding and implementation. Effective coding practices are essential. Subsequently, the testing phase ensures functionality and quality. Rigorous testing minimizes errors. Finally, the deployment phase releases the software to users. Timely deployment is critical for market success.

Common Methodologies Used in Game Development

Common methodologies in game development include Agile, Waterfall, and Scrum. Each methodology offers distinct advantages. Agile promotes flexibility and iterative progress. This allows for rapid adjustments based on feedback. Waterfall follows a linear approach, emphasizing thorough documentation. It is suitable for projects with well-defined requirements. Scrum, a subset of Agile, focuses on short sprints. This enhances team collaboration and accountability. Effective methodology selection is crucial. It impacts project success significantly.

What is DevOps?

DevOps is a set of practices that integrates development and operations. This approach enhances collaboration and efficiency. By breaking down silos, teams can respond faster to changes. Continuous integration and delivery are key components. They streamline the deployment process significantly. Automation tools facilitate these practices effectively. He can reduce manual errors and save clip. Ultimately, DevOps fosters a culture of innovation. Quick iterations lead to improved product quality.

Tools and Technologies for DevOps

Various tools and technologies facilitate DevOps practices. Popular options include Jenkins for continuous integration. This automates the testing and deployment process. Docker enables containerization, enhancing application portability. He can streamline development environments effectively. Kubernetes manages container orchestration, ensuring scalability. Monitoring tools like Prometheus provide real-time insights. These tools enhance operational efficiency significantly. Proper tool selection is crucial for success.

Potential Drawbacks of Automation

Automation can introduce several potential drawbacks. Initial setup costs for automation tools can be high. This may strain limited budgets. Additionally, over-reliance on automation can lead to complacency. Teams might overlook critical manual testing. Furthermore, automation requires ongoing maintenance and updates. He must ensure tools remain effective. Lastly, not all tasks are suitable for automation. Some processes require human intuition.
